Output 89959f82f37d3619c80974acfdb9c15a5481ccdfaf2a981f91c8f384cdc5ced5:0

value
63679485
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de083c3da283ffec8e48f24d1b3ab856c1565e8b OP_EQUALVERIFY OP_CHECKSIG
address
1MEzsnbTEdoMSDkvjg2FJZgb4bVzS28WBS
transaction
89959f82f37d3619c80974acfdb9c15a5481ccdfaf2a981f91c8f384cdc5ced5
confirmations
518394
spent
true